Mazzetti’s Lighting Design Studio is seeking an experienced Senior Lighting Designer with 6–12 years of professional experience to support and lead the development of high‑quality lighting solutions across a wide range of project types. In this role, you will take a hands‑on approach to design execution—developing lighting concepts, performing calculations and energy analysis, producing drawings and specifications, and contributing to client presentations.
YourTasks Will Involve
- Contributing to lighting design development from concept through construction, with opportunities to grow into a project leadership role
- Performing lighting calculations, energy analysis, and photometric modeling
- Producing and coordinating lighting drawings, details, and specifications
- Developing renderings, diagrams, and presentation materials for internal and client‑facing use
- Coordinating work within the Mazzetti team and with other disciplines
- Coordinating lighting scope with internal Mazzetti teams, as well as architectural, electrical, and engineering disciplines
- Supporting sustainability goals, including energy efficiency, day lighting, and LEED‑related efforts
- Participating in construction‑phase services, including submittal reviews and design intent support and site visits
- Managing assigned tasks, schedules, and deliverables
- Contributing to a diverse portfolio of projects including healthcare, hospitality, civic, commercial, and residential work
- Integrating sustainable lighting strategies into all phases of design
